About Ambrolite Syrup

Ambrolite Syrup is primarily used to treat cough. It also treats acute (short-term) and chronic (long-term) respiratory diseases characterised by excess mucus. Coughing is the body’s way of clearing irritants (such as allergens, mucus, or smoke) from the airways.

Ambrolite Syrup contains Ambroxol, which works by thinning and loosening phlegm (mucus) in the lungs, windpipe, and nose.

Ambrolite Syrup may cause side effects such as nausea, changes in taste, and numbness in the mouth, tongue, and throat. Most of these side effects do not require medical attention and gradually resolve over time. However, if the side effects persist or worsen, please consult your doctor.

If you are known to be allergic to Ambrolite Syrup or any other medicines, please tell your doctor. If you are pregnant or breastfeeding, it is advised to inform your doctor before using Ambrolite Syrup . If you have had kidney or liver problems, stomach ulcers, asthma, or a cough for a long time, please inform your doctor before taking Ambrolite Syrup .

Uses of Ambrolite Syrup

Ambrolite Syrup is used to treat Cough, Respiratory disorder with a viscous cough. The detailed uses of Ambrolite Syrup are as follows:

  • Cough suppressant: Ambrolite Syrup helps to relieve coughs caused by excess mucus, making it easier to breathe and feel more comfortable during colds or flu.
  • Chest congestion relief: Ambrolite Syrup relieves chest congestion caused by excess mucus by making it easier to breathe and cough up mucus.

Directions for Use

  • Ambrolite Syrup can be taken with or without food.
  • It is usually taken 2-3 times daily at the same time each day or as directed by your doctor.
  • Shake the bottle well before each use.
  • Take the prescribed dose by mouth using the measuring cup/dropper provided with the pack.
  • Avoid using regular household spoons, as they may not measure the dose correctly.

How Ambrolite Syrup Works

Ambrolite Syrup contains Ambroxol that works by thinning and loosening phlegm (mucus) in lungs, windpipe and nose. Ambrolite Syrup breakdown the acid mucopolysaccharide fibres that make the mucous (sputum) thinner and less dense/viscous removing sputum efficiently by coughing. However, the viscosity of sputum remains low for as long as treatment is maintained.

Drug Warnings

  • Talk to your doctor before taking Ambrolite Syrup if you have had a cough for a long time, have asthma or suffer from serious asthma attacks, have liver or kidney problems, or have peptic or duodenal ulcers.
  • There have been reports of severe skin allergic reactions with Ambrolite Syrup , so if you develop a skin rash, stop using Ambrolite Syrup immediately and contact your doctor immediately.
  • If you are allergic to some sugars, please inform your doctor as Ambrolite Syrup may contain sorbitol.
  • You are recommended not to take Ambrolite Syrup for more than 10 days without your doctor’s advice.

Diet & Lifestyle Advise

Healthy diet:

  • To help thin mucus and promote its elimination, consume plenty of warm liquids, such as water, soups, and herbal teas.
  • To promote immunity and healing, eat a well-balanced diet full of vitamin-rich fruits and vegetables.
  • Incorporate vitamin C-rich foods, including citrus fruits, to aid in the fight against respiratory infections.
  • Avoid fatty, greasy, and extremely cold foods if they exacerbate cough symptoms or produce more mucus.

Physical activity:

  • To enhance breathing and mucus clearance, engage in light exercise such as walking or simple stretching.
  • To promote lung function and reduce chest congestion, practice deep breathing exercises.
  • If you feel exhausted, out of breath, or unwell, avoid physically demanding tasks and get enough rest while you heal.

Stress management:

  • To enhance lung function and promote mental relaxation, practice deep-breathing exercises.
  • To aid in the body's recovery from respiratory illnesses, get enough sleep and rest.
  • Take part in relaxing pursuits such as meditation, light reading, or soothing music.

Pregnancy

Unsafe

Ambrolite Syrup is a Category C pregnancy drug and is not recommended for pregnant women, especially in the first 3 months, as it may cause harm to the unborn baby.

bannner image

Breast Feeding

Unsafe

Avoid breastfeeding while taking Ambrolite Syrup as it may be excreted in breast milk and cause adverse effects in the baby.

bannner image

Driving

Safe if prescribed

Ambrolite Syrup usually does not affect your ability to drive or operate machinery.

FAQs

Ambrolite Syrup is used to treat Dry cough and respiratory disorders with viscous cough.

Ambroxol works by thinning and loosening phlegm (mucus) in the lungs, windpipe, and nose. Ambrolite Syrup breaks the acid mucopolysaccharide fibres that make the mucous (sputum) thinner and less dense/viscous, helping it be coughed up more efficiently.

No, Ambrolite Syrup is not recommended during pregnancy, especially in the first 3 months, as it may harm the developing baby. Therefore, if you are pregnant or planning a pregnancy, please inform your doctor before taking Ambrolite Syrup .

You are recommended to take Ambrolite Syrup for as long as your doctor has prescribed it. However, if the symptoms worsen or persist after 5 days (3 days in children) of using Ambrolite Syrup , please consult your doctor.

Yes, Ambrolite Syrup may cause severe skin reactions in some people. It is not necessary for everyone taking Ambrolite Syrup to have skin reactions. However, if you notice a skin rash including lesions of the nose, throat, mouth, genitals or eyes, stop taking Ambrolite Syrup and consult a doctor immediately.

Yes, you may take Ambrolite Syrup with antibiotics such as erythromycin, amoxicillin, doxycycline and cefuroxime as it may increase the concentration of antibiotics in the formed mucus in the airways. However, you are recommended to consult a doctor before using Ambrolite Syrup with antibiotics or any other medicines.

No, you are not recommended to stop taking Ambrolite Syrup without consulting your doctor as it may worsen cough or cause recurring symptoms. Therefore, take Ambrolite Syrup for as long as your doctor has prescribed it and if you experience any difficulty while taking Ambrolite Syrup , please consult your doctor.

No, Ambrolite Syrup is not typically recommended for dry coughs. It's designed to thin and loosen mucus, making it effective for productive (wet) coughs, not dry coughs without mucus.

Ambrolite Syrup usually doesn't cause drowsiness and is safe for daytime use. However, everyone's body is different, so if you notice unusual side effects, take necessary precautions. If your condition worsens, consult your doctor.

Take it preferably with food to avoid stomach upset or as advised by the doctor. Swallow whole with a glass of water.

The most common side effects of Ambrolite Syrup include nausea, changes in taste, and numbness in the mouth, tongue, and throat. These side effects are usually mild and temporary, resolving as your body adjusts to the medication. However, if any side effects persist or worsen, you must consult your doctor for proper guidance and care.

Ambrolite Syrup is usually not recommended during breastfeeding; it may be excreted in breast milk and cause adverse effects in the baby.
